  • Welcome to Unlimited Opinions! Have you ever wanted to listen to a lawyer and his son discuss philosophy, mythology, theology, politics and more? No? Well, Mark and Adam Bishop are here to discuss it all the same! From philosophy to mythology to politics, they discuss it all with rants and tangents galore! Now in Season 9, they're discussing Orestes Brownson's "The American Republic: Its Constitution, Tendencies, and Destiny," going chapter by chapter to examine how Brownson views the nature of government and the role of providence in the foundation and future of the United States. There will also be more than the average amount of references to linguistics, 80s movies, and J.R.R. Tolkien. If any of that sounds vaguely interesting, then this is the podcast for you!   • S9 E1: Introduction to Orestes Brownson's "The American Republic"
    2024/07/27

    A new season, with a more optimistic topic! For this season, we'll be reading Orestes Brownson's 1865 work The American Republic: Its Constitution, Tendencies, and Destinies. In this book, Brownson, a former socialist and Catholic convert, discusses what the nature of America really is and what it should be, as guided by providence and the truth. Brownson's words are especially prescient in this time, and even in our first discussion of his preface and introduction, we see his desire for the truth and humility everywhere.

  • S8 E14: Season Finale - Who's Right? And How Can You Tell?
    2024/07/09

    Good riddance to George Lakoff's Moral Politics! In this season finale, we discuss the last section of Lakoff's book, in which he lays out his reasons for being a liberal. His reasons are of course based on his book-long characterization of conservatives as being stupid, crazy, and evil, so his stance is not exactly one we agree with. We also discuss what pieces of value we gained from reading this book and lessons for the future as we move on to Season 9!

  • S8 E13: How Can You Love Your Country and Hate Your Government?
    2024/07/02

    This guy doesn't even know about federalism! Join us as we discuss George Lakoff's magnificent discussion on how he is confused by the concept of federalism, and how he divides up other varieties of liberals and conservatives. We also discuss how Lakoff fundamentally refutes his entire book, insinuates that conservatives are one step away from being violent extremists, and doesn't seem to know much of anything at all. We also diss libertarians and talk about all of the problems with the modern Classics field!
